# GAGurine_df data seet
library(testthat)
library(MedDataSets)
# Test that GAGurine_df has the correct structure
test_that("GAGurine_df has the correct structure", {
expect_s3_class(GAGurine_df, "data.frame")
# Dimensions test
expect_equal(nrow(GAGurine_df), 314)
expect_equal(ncol(GAGurine_df), 2)
# Column names test
expected_names <- c("Age", "GAG")
expect_equal(names(GAGurine_df), expected_names)
})
# Test that GAGurine_df has correct data types
test_that("GAGurine_df has correct data types", {
# Numeric columns
expect_type(GAGurine_df$Age, "double")
expect_type(GAGurine_df$GAG, "double")
})
# Test that GAGurine_df has no NA values
test_that("GAGurine_df has no NA values", {
expect_false(any(is.na(GAGurine_df)))
})
# Test that GAGurine_df values are in valid ranges
test_that("GAGurine_df has values in valid ranges", {
# Check if numeric values are finite
expect_true(all(is.finite(GAGurine_df$Age)))
expect_true(all(is.finite(GAGurine_df$GAG)))
# Example logical ranges (you may adjust these as necessary)
expect_true(all(GAGurine_df$Age >= 0)) # Assuming age cannot be negative
expect_true(all(GAGurine_df$GAG >= 0)) # Assuming GAG values cannot be negative
})
